Output 57a0bd7a8580a475409b6bebddc719b7ab4542540fca2fac6959cb9b80d86c90:0

value
174319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8f992a1f7a30943e3c588a013b95002facd3aa OP_EQUAL
address
3Cs4PLCQkHDJeqjDqyhYXowcpc6RL6Kc5f
transaction
57a0bd7a8580a475409b6bebddc719b7ab4542540fca2fac6959cb9b80d86c90
confirmations
146588
spent
true